Hi
Try with 120 seconds delay. Also use environment variable to depicting to get 
email whensoever event triggers.
Ami



On Wednesday, March 5, 2014 10:01 AM, Oliver Boehmer (oboehmer) 
<oboeh...@cisco.com> wrote:
  
can you just remove the "action 2.0 reload" from the script for the test so the 
router just spits out the syslog and then send the logs?
I noticed that the maximum "delay down" value accepted by the parser is 180 (3 
minutes), maybe it didn't accept the command when you pasted it? I just tested 
this (with 60 sec delay), and it seems to work fine ("debug track" enabled):


router(config)#

Mar  5 09:53:14.230: Track: 99 Down change delayed for 60 secs

Mar  5 09:54:14.231: Track: 99 Down change delay expired

Mar  5 09:54:14.231: Track: 99 Change #3 ip sla 99, reachability Up->Down

Mar  5 09:54:14.231: %TRACKING-5-STATE: 99 ip sla 99 reachability Up->Down

Mar  5 09:54:14.239: %HA_EM-6-LOG: reload-if-down: Reloading the router due to 
unreachability

and as EEM only triggers on up->down transition, it only takes action when the 
probe was up at least once. so this is good..

oli

From: M K <gunner_...@live.com<mailto:gunner_...@live.com>>
Date: Wednesday, 5 March 2014 09:26
To: Oliver Boehmer <oboeh...@cisco.com<mailto:oboeh...@cisco.com>>, 
"cisco-nsp@puck.nether.net<mailto:cisco-nsp@puck.nether.net>" 
<cisco-nsp@puck.nether.net<mailto:cisco-nsp@puck.nether.net>>
Subject: RE: [c-nsp] Event Manager Script

Hi , thanks and sorry for the late reply
I am facing some issues with the script , when the IP SLA is down , the router 
did not wait for the 5 minutes , it reloaded directly

> From: oboeh...@cisco.com<mailto:oboeh...@cisco.com>
> To: gunner_...@live.com<mailto:gunner_...@live.com>; 
> cisco-nsp@puck.nether.net<mailto:cisco-nsp@puck.nether.net>

> Subject: Re: [c-nsp] Event Manager Script
> Date: Sun, 2 Mar 2014 12:33:34 +0000
>
>
>
> >Hi allI am trying to do a event manager script that will do the below and
> >need some assistanceI want to ping to a specific destination and if the
> >ping request timed out for a period of for example 5 minutes , the router
> >should be reloaded
>
> not sure whether this is a good idea or not (the router could reload
> forever), here is a way to achieve the goal:
>
> ip sla 1
> icmp-echo <destination-addr>
> frequency 20
> ip sla schedule 1 life forever start-time now
> !
>
> track 1 ip sla 1 reachability
> delay down 300
> !
> event manager applet reload-if-down
> event track 1 state down
> action 1.0 syslog msg "Reloading the router due to unreachability"
> action 2.0 reload
>
> hope this helps..
>
> oli
>
_______________________________________________
cisco-nsp mailing list  cisco-nsp@puck.nether.net
https://puck.nether.net/mailman/listinfo/cisco-nsp
archive at http://puck.nether.net/pipermail/cisco-nsp/
_______________________________________________
cisco-nsp mailing list  cisco-nsp@puck.nether.net
https://puck.nether.net/mailman/listinfo/cisco-nsp
archive at http://puck.nether.net/pipermail/cisco-nsp/

Reply via email to